Home Minister Proposes Special Jails for Fugitives to Meet International Standards
16 October, 2025
Union Home Minister Amit Shah has urged all states to create special prisons for fugitives that comply with international human rights standards. The proposal aims to counter arguments made by fugitives like Vijay Mallya and Nirav Modi in foreign courts that poor prison conditions in India would violate their rights, thereby stalling extradition. Shah also suggested automatically cancelling the passports of individuals against whom an Interpol red notice is issued to restrict their international travel and expedite their return to face justice.
